RCOG/RCM/RCPCH Statement on story 'Government backtracks to hand maternity to GPs' (Health Service Journal(HSJ), 8 November 2010) - 9 November 2010
The Royal College of Obstetricians and Gynaecologists (RCOG), Royal College of Midwives (RCM) and Royal College of Paediatrics and Child Health (RCPCH) are extremely concerned by the reports that the commissioning of maternity services will now be undertaken by GP Consortia rather than the National Commissioning Board, as proposed in the White Paper.
